当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

阿里云服务器部署web项目需要设置虚拟环境吗,阿里云服务器部署Web项目,是否需要设置虚拟环境及其详细步骤解析

阿里云服务器部署web项目需要设置虚拟环境吗,阿里云服务器部署Web项目,是否需要设置虚拟环境及其详细步骤解析

阿里云服务器部署Web项目通常需要设置虚拟环境以确保项目依赖的版本管理。设置虚拟环境的详细步骤包括:登录服务器,安装虚拟环境工具(如virtualenv或venv),创...

阿里云服务器部署web项目通常需要设置虚拟环境以确保项目依赖的版本管理。设置虚拟环境的详细步骤包括:登录服务器,安装虚拟环境工具(如virtualenv或venv),创建虚拟环境,激活虚拟环境,安装项目依赖,并配置环境变量。具体步骤请参考相关文档进行操作。

在当今互联网时代,Web项目的部署已经成为了企业、个人开发者必备的技能,阿里云作为国内领先的服务商,提供了丰富的云服务器资源,在部署Web项目时,是否需要设置虚拟环境?本文将为您详细解析。

什么是虚拟环境?

虚拟环境是指在Python等编程语言中,为特定项目创建一个独立的运行环境,该环境包含项目所需的依赖库,虚拟环境的作用主要有以下几点:

阿里云服务器部署web项目需要设置虚拟环境吗,阿里云服务器部署Web项目,是否需要设置虚拟环境及其详细步骤解析

1、避免依赖库之间的冲突,确保项目运行稳定;

2、方便项目迁移,提高项目可移植性;

3、保护系统环境,避免项目依赖库对系统环境造成影响。

二、阿里云服务器部署Web项目是否需要设置虚拟环境?

对于阿里云服务器部署Web项目,是否需要设置虚拟环境取决于以下几个因素:

1、项目依赖库是否较多:如果项目依赖库较多,且存在版本冲突,建议设置虚拟环境;

2、项目是否需要迁移:如果项目需要迁移到其他服务器或本地环境,建议设置虚拟环境;

3、服务器环境是否稳定:如果服务器环境较为稳定,且不需要频繁更新依赖库,可以考虑不设置虚拟环境。

三、阿里云服务器部署Web项目设置虚拟环境的步骤

以下以Python为例,为您详细介绍阿里云服务器部署Web项目设置虚拟环境的步骤:

阿里云服务器部署web项目需要设置虚拟环境吗,阿里云服务器部署Web项目,是否需要设置虚拟环境及其详细步骤解析

1、登录阿里云服务器,进入命令行界面;

2、安装Python虚拟环境工具pip(如果已安装,请跳过此步骤):

   sudo apt-get update
   sudo apt-get install python3-pip

3、安装virtualenv:

   pip3 install virtualenv

4、创建虚拟环境:

   virtualenv venv

venv是虚拟环境的名称,您可以根据需求修改。

5、激活虚拟环境:

- 在Linux和macOS系统中,使用以下命令激活虚拟环境:

     source venv/bin/activate

- 在Windows系统中,使用以下命令激活虚拟环境:

     .envScriptsctivate

6、安装项目依赖库:

在激活虚拟环境后,进入项目目录,使用pip安装项目所需的依赖库:

阿里云服务器部署web项目需要设置虚拟环境吗,阿里云服务器部署Web项目,是否需要设置虚拟环境及其详细步骤解析

   pip install -r requirements.txt

requirements.txt是项目依赖库的清单文件。

7、部署Web项目:

根据项目类型(如Django、Flask等)进行部署,以下以Django为例:

- 创建Django项目:

     django-admin startproject myproject

- 创建Django应用:

     python manage.py startapp myapp

- 运行Django项目:

     python manage.py runserver 0.0.0.0:8000

至此,阿里云服务器部署Web项目设置虚拟环境的步骤已完成。

黑狐家游戏

发表评论

最新文章